Looking for some good news during this pandemic? Amy Schumer‘s baby boy is already 1-years-old and that my friends, is worth celebrating.

Schumer regularly would poke fun throughout her pregnancy due to sharing a due date with the Duchess of Sussex Meghan Markle as they were expecting at the same time. Ultimately, Schumer ended up giving birth to her and husband Chris Fischer‘s first child, Gene, just a few hours prior to Archie Harrison‘s arrival. 

“10:55 pm last night,” the comedian posted to Instagram on May 6, 2019, with the perfect caption: “Our royal baby was born.”

And now 12 months later, Schumer wished her son’s very 1st birthday in a simple but heart warming way.

“I’m really glad it was you,” she captioned a photo of them snoozing. “Hbd.”

And while the baby boy is growing in size, that is not the only aspect of his life that has changed.

Just last month, Schumer announced they had decided to change his middle name for…..pronunciation purposes.

“So do you guys know that Gene, our baby’s name is officially changed?” she asked her listeners on her podcast, Amy Schumer Presents: 3 Girls, 1 Keith.

“It’s now Gene David Fischer. It was Gene Attell Fischer but we realized that we by accident named our son, ‘genital.'”

But besides the quirky error, Schumer is adoring motherhood.

“The hype is real. Believe the hype,” she revealed to E! News of motherhood just six months after he was born. “I’m so lucky.”
